It helps homeowners get new windows approved by homeowners.    FENSA is the acronym for Fenestration Self-Assessment Scheme. It was established in April 2002 in order to address the changing building regulations regarding replacement windows, roof lights, and doors. It has six bodies that monitor and equip their members to self-certify their installations. Select a FENSA approved installer to be sure that your installation will meet the local building regulations and will be registered at your council.    A FENSA approved installer will offer the warranty of five to ten years and an insurance-backed warranty for their products.
